Hi, I've been looking at picking up a set of Imperial Boots for my TD.  My shoe size is 10.5 US, and they suggest to buy a size larger.  However, they don't have a 11.5, just an 11 and a 12.  Would I be okay buying an 11, or should I go with the 12?

I just ordered mine at a full size up (ordered a 14). They're saying - and a few other users saying - that you can pad the extra space w/ inserts. 

Your feet also swell if you walk around in it for a long time.

I normally wear 11 myself, so I ordered the 11.5, length wise was spot on, but they got really narrow towards the tip, and are painful to walk around in. Now looking to see if I can find any 12's stateside. If you have wide toes, I'd grab the 12's. Worst case, you run thick socks or add inserts.
